Course Content

• Introduction to Blockchain Technology and its Applications in Finance
• Decentralized Finance (DeFi) and its Potential for Nonprofits
• Smart Contracts and their Use in Nonprofit Operations
• Blockchain for Nonprofit Transparency and Accountability
• Cryptocurrencies and Digital Asset Management for Nonprofits
• Security and Risk Management in Blockchain for Nonprofits
• Fundraising and Donation Management using Blockchain
• Legal and Regulatory Frameworks for Blockchain in the Nonprofit Sector
• Case Studies: Blockchain Implementations in Nonprofit Organizations
• Blockchain for Supply Chain Transparency in Nonprofit Projects

A Postgraduate Certificate in Blockchain for Nonprofit Finance is increasingly significant in the UK’s evolving charitable sector. The UK boasts over 170,000 registered charities, managing billions of pounds annually. However, traditional financial systems often struggle with transparency and efficiency, leading to operational bottlenecks and hindering impactful resource allocation. Blockchain technology offers a transformative solution, providing enhanced security, traceability, and accountability for donations and financial transactions. This Postgraduate Certificate equips professionals with the skills to leverage blockchain’s potential, addressing the critical need for greater transparency and trust within the sector. The course covers practical applications, including smart contracts for streamlined grant management and secure donation platforms. This directly addresses industry needs as many charities are exploring blockchain solutions to improve efficiency and build greater donor confidence.
